"C:\Users\<YourUserName>\AppData\Roaming\7DaysToDie\Saves\<World Name>\<Save Name>"
An easy way to reach the Roaming folder specifically is to do a search via the windows bar and search '%appdata%' and select the roaming folder that should appear in the list, the 7dtd folder will be near the top of the new window.
Then navigate into the saves folder, whichever world name is the right one, and backup the entire folder of whichever one has the right save name.
